Spotting Signs of Problem Gambling

It creeps up on you. Red flags are chasing losses by upping stakes, wagering cash meant for bills, fibbing about your betting, or getting anxious without it. If you see yourself here, get help from a support group now.

More signals: using games to dodge your problems, taking loans to bet, or letting work and loved ones slip. They're not faults - they're signs that betting went from fun to how you handle stress.

Is there a way to block gambling on all betting sites, not just Habtam Bet?

Closing your account here stops you from betting with us only. For a ban across every licensed operator, reach out to your country's gambling authority or nonprofits such as BeGambleAware and GamCare - they oversee cross-platform exclusion schemes.

How can I help someone I believe is struggling with gambling?

Talk to them with empathy and no blame. Point them toward services like Gambling Therapy or GamCare. Push them to get advice from a counselor or their doctor. You can reach out to help groups yourself for advice. People do recover from gambling issues when they get the right help.

Can I count on recovering the money I lose when I gamble?

No, there's no guarantee. Real money is at risk when you bet. Games rely on randomness and math that favours the house. Never spend cash you can't spare. Think of it as entertainment you're paying for, never as income or a way to get back what you've lost.
